Wubbo de Jong
author
Wubbo de Jong (1946–2002) was a prominent Dutch photographer, widely regarded as one of the most important photojournalists in the Netherlands during the post-war period. He specialized in reportage, documentary, and portrait photography, working for many years as a top photographer for the newspaper Het Parool. His work spanned international crises, including reporting on Vietnam, Ethiopia, and Rwanda. He was also a significant contributor to Dutch documentary and commercial photography, often documenting cultural shifts and social movements.[1,2]
